Rear axle nut size.

Does anyone know the size of the rear axle nut on the 1700s? I wanted to adjust final belt tension last week and discovered I'll never get a socket wrench on it without taking the muffler off, so I need to get a rear axle nut wrench.

I think it is a 22mm but I will check when I get home. I was able to remove it by lifting the bike until the nut was between the muffler and the frame. Torque spec is 80 ft. lbs.

The head on the axle is 22mm, the nut takes a 27mm wrench.
